Features

What we deliver

Information architecture

Structure content into consistent hierarchies (topics, products, versions) so retrieval has clean boundaries.

Ownership and update workflows

Define owners, review cycles, and change tracking so knowledge stays fresh and trustworthy.

Permission-aware organization

Design access boundaries and metadata so retrieval respects roles and tenant isolation.

Ingestion and normalization

Normalize docs, wikis, and help centers into consistent formats with stable IDs and metadata.

Freshness and drift monitoring

Detect stale content and drift using change signals and evaluation queries.

Quality playbooks

Guidelines for authorship, formatting, and content updates that keep RAG quality high long-term.

Use Cases

Who this is for

Support knowledge base cleanup

Reduce contradictory answers by restructuring and standardizing support content and ownership.

Enterprise internal documentation

Permission-aware knowledge architecture for SOPs, policies, and internal runbooks.

Product documentation organization

Versioned content structure so assistants answer correctly for the right product versions.

Multi-source knowledge consolidation

Consolidate Notion/Confluence/Drive/Help Center into a coherent retrieval-ready structure.

RAG quality stabilization

Fix knowledge issues that cause retrieval errors and hallucination-like behavior in answers.
